Transaction 3259426d99e7dcf30e9afdad0a723188ef3f6a190f9b5dee734f43319c1419b0
1 Input
1 Output
-
3259426d99e7dcf30e9afdad0a723188ef3f6a190f9b5dee734f43319c1419b0:0
- value
- 408779
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2583fe0c853992e3aa54a061ea364e5af555505 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HFzzq9qkTVNHsruekg3Js5Zvp6DvSYaxW